The 2025 VCC is a blend of 80% merlot, 15% Cabernet Franc and 5% Cabernet Sauvignon, the harvest was completed in just 10 days. Hugely impressive, there is a gorgeous nose of violets, cocoa nibs, liquorice root. There is no hint of excess on the palate, with wonderfully sculpted tannins that are seamlessly integrated with hedgerow fruit. One of the standouts from the appellation this year.
The 2025 Vieux Château Certan was picked from September 8 to 15 at 22 hl/ha and includes two conjoining parcels normally used for the La Gravette. It is raised in two-thirds new oak, the remainder one-year-old. The Merlot sculpts the bouquet with perfumed red cherries, raspberry, cassis and pressed violet scents that gain intensity in the glass. The oak is seamlessly integrated. The palate is medium-bodied, with powdery tannins on the entry. This must be one of the most peppery VCCs that I have tasted, poivre noir from the Cabernet Franc component. Quite structured, with chalky tannins on the finish, almost as if it came from more limestone soil. Not a crowd pleaser like the 2022, but an intellectual, vertical VCC that will flesh out in barrel. 14.01% alcohol.
